DHL Jordan Honda launches EJ12

AS expected, Jordan announced international carrier DHL as its title sponsor at the launch of the new EJ12 in a Brussels airport hangar on Friday. The red DHL logo will run on the side pods of the EJ12, in deep contrast to the team's signature yellow, and the team will race under the name DHL Jordan Honda.

"This is an exciting and historic day for the team," said Eddie Jordan. "After two excellent years working with Deutsche Post WorldNet, we have reached an agreement with them whereby their DHL brand becomes the title sponsor of our team. There is much talk of tough times in Formula One, but this agreement demonstrates that our sport continues to provide an excellent global marketing platform.Ê We are very much looking forward to the year ahead together racing as DHL Jordan Honda."

Eddie also thanked Gallaher Ltd., whose Benson and Hedges brand was the previous title sponsor, but is lessening their support as tobacco advertising is squeezed out of the sport.

The EJ12 was first seen on the track a month ago, and has been tested in Spain and England since by Giancarlo Fisichella and Takuma Sato. The cars will now be prepared for shipment to Melbourne for the first round of the 2002 season, for which practice begins in one week.
